Senator Seriake Dickson, representing Bayelsa West Senatorial District, has endorsed the 10th Annual Memorial celebration of the late Ijaw musician King Robert Ebizimor JP. The endorsement came on Monday when the event’s organizers, including the late musician’s children, visited the Senator at his country home in Toru-Orua, Sagbama Local Government Area, Bayelsa.
Expressing his excitement about the program, Senator Dickson assured the team of his presence at the ceremony. He also promised to set up a committee to mobilize the Ijaw nation in honoring the late legend’s remarkable contributions to the music industry.
The organizers have also visited other notable Ijaw figures, including Chief S. Smooth, AKA De Paddle of Niger Delta, at his Warri residence in Delta State.
King Robert Ebizimor, a foremost Ijaw musician, passed away in 2014 in a tragic motor accident along the Warri/Ughelli highway. He is fondly remembered for his timeless tunes and evergreen songs.
